A heat exchanger or commonly referred to as a heat exchanger is a tool that is commonly used in the industrial world. The function of this tool is to cool down a fluid. There are various types of heat exchangers, including shell and tube. The purpose of this research is to design a heat exchanger that is good and correct and has a fairly high effectiveness in accordance with the existing heat exchanger design rules. The object of this research is a heat exchanger with a size of OD in, 16 BWG with stainless steel material which has a counter current type which is used to cool the type of air at a temperature of 80°C to 60°C with the help of an air type fluid also at a temperature of 60°C. 30°C. The effectiveness of the tool is quite large, namely 88.7%.
